Andrew McCutchen finished 2-for-4 with a homer and three RBI in Saturday's 8-6 defeat of the Marlins. McCutchen singled in the third inning and then launched a massive three-run bomb over the left-center field wall in the fourth. He has been among the hottest hitters in baseball since the beginning of June and boasts a .323/.434/.554 overall slash line in 67 games played. The reigning 2014 NL MVP is on pace for 26 homers and 98 RBI. Pittsburgh has won 16 of its last 24 games and is back at .500.

Andrew McCutchen homered, doubled and walked twice against the Cubs on Wednesday. McCutchen was having a rather ho-hum season 10 days ago. Now he has six homers in June, taking his season total from four to 10 and his OPS from .862 to .976. Last year, he won MVP honors with a .911 OPS. Of course, McCutchen won't be MVP again unless his teammates join him in playing a whole lot better, but he's just as valuable as ever.

Andrew McCutchen went 2-for-4 with a two-run home run in Tuesday's loss to the Cubs. McCutchen tied the game up at two apiece with a third-inning home run off of lefty Travis Wood. The defending NL MVP is having another great season, slashing .312/.426/.521 with nine home runs, 33 RBI, and seven stolen bases on the season.

Andrew McCutchen had a two-run homer and an RBI double as part of the Pirates victory Monday. McCutchen is ramping up the power, with four homers already this month after he hit four in April and then none in May. He actually has 10 extra-base hits in eight games in June after collecting a total of 18 in his first 54 games of the year.

Andrew McCutchen went 2-for-4 with a double in Sunday's shutout loss to the Brewers. McCutchen was the only Pirates hitter who was able to do much of anything against Yovani Gallardo and the Brewers bullpen. He's hit in six of his last seven games, bringing his season line to .305/.422/.491. His .913 OPS is sixth-best in the National League, as it's another strong year for the 27-year-old.

Andrew McCutchen went 1-for-4 with a solo home run in Wednesday's loss to the Padres. McCutchen went deep off of Ian Kennedy in the fourth inning to make it a 2-1 ballgame. The homer was his sixth of the season and boosts his slash line up to .299/.420/.472 with 26 RBI.

Andrew McCutchen had a big day at the plate in Sunday's victory over the Dodgers, going 3-for-4 with a homer and a pair of doubles. McCutchen also crossed the plate three times on the evening. His solo shot came courtesy of Zack Greinke in the third inning and increased the Pirates advantage to 3-1 at the time. He's off to an outstanding start to his 2014 campaign, hitting .307/.427/.470 with five homers and 24 RBI.

Andrew McCutchen was hit by a pitch, drew a walk, and singled in four trips to the plate in Thursday's win over the Nationals. With the bases loaded, McCutchen was hit by Blake Treinen to force in a run in the bottom of the third to put the Pirates up 1-0. He put the Pirates back on top with an RBI single in the bottom of the fifth to make it 2-1. Now with 23 RBI, the defending NL MVP is slashing .319/.442/.488.

Andrew McCutchen went 3-for-5 with a pair of doubles, an RBI, and two runs scored in Wednesday's win over the Orioles. The Pirates needed every ounce of McCutchen's lumber on Wednesday. The center fielder is now slashing .317/.436/.488 with 21 RBI and 23 runs scored. Just another productive year for the three-time All-Star.

Andrew McCutchen went 2-for-3 with a walk and two singles in Tuesday's loss to the Orioles. McCutchen put the Pirates up 1-0 in the third inning with an RBI single, but it was a lead his team would soon relinquish. McCutchen also drew another walk, pushing his league-leading total up to 35. He is now slashing .308/.431/.472. He slugged over .500 in each of the last two seasons, so it wouldn't be shocking to see him eventually cross that threshold with more time.
